THREE DIMENSIONAL ANIMATION OF THE TRANS JOGJA BUS TOUR LINE USING PATH TECHNIQUE Nurcahyani Dewi Retnowati; Anggraini Kusumaningrum; Fatimatuzzahroh Fatimatuzzahroh

Abstract

Three-dimensional animation is widely used in various needs, one of its applications can be used as a medium for information on Trans Jogja bus tour line. This information media is useful for Trans Jogja bus users in knowing bus routes so that it is easier to use Jogja Trans buses. In the design of three-dimensional animation, the Trans Jogja bus route uses Paths techniques in the 3D Blender software and in making the application display using Construct 2 software. The design is then implemented in the form of animated videos. The 3D animation application of the Trans Jogja Bus route that is published on the itch.io site gets as many as 115 views and that downloads as many as 127.
Analysis of Combination Knowledge Acquisition of Haar Training for Object Detection on the Viola Jones Method Haruno Sajati; Anggraini Kusumaningrum; Nur Hanifah

Abstract

Viola Jones method uses the file classifier to object detection. The training process to create object classifier file requires very high computer resources and time which is directly proportional to the amount of training data. The amount of training data determines the accuracy of object detection. The long training process is caused because the computer has low specifications and the distribution of Haartraining files will speed up the process of vector file formation, minimize errors when cutting Haar features on positive objects and also minimize errors that occur during the training process. The problems that arise next are how to overcome this so that a better knowledge is obtained. This study provides analysis results of the process of merging knowledge acquisition and its effect on the accuracy of object detection using the Viola-Jones method with the final result undetected object decrease 52.62% and object detected increase 23.78%
SENDING DRONE FLYING SPEED DATA USING ANDROID-BASED CLIENT SERVER METHOD Daewu Gus Bintara Putra; Anggraini Kusumaningrum

Abstract

Abstract - Drones as Unmanned Aerial Vehicle that are controlled using remote control are experiencing better development. The speed of the drone that cannot be accessed on the remote control can be determined through a client-server based application. The client side application, named Mydrone, is placed on the drone while on the server side, named Admin Drone, on earth. Mydrone and Admin Drone are applications made in this research based on andorid. This application on the client and server is used to monitor the speed of flying drones by using the Google Play Service library. Data sent from the client to the server in realtime by using Google Firebase. From the tests carried out it can be seen the speed of the drone when flying horisontal ly, while when flying vertically the speed is not detected. Battery capacity will also decrease when the speed of the drone gets faster, this is seen in the data when the speed is 8,741 km / h, the electricity demand taken from the battery is 31%.
WEB-BASED DECISION SUPPORT SYSTEM FOR GUEST STAR DETERMINATION IN E-MARKETPLACE USING WEIGHTED PRODUCT METHOD Asih Pujiastuti; Anggraini Kusumaningrum; Muhammad Ali Sofyan

Abstract

At an event, the event organizer usually requires guest stars as performers. Event organizers often find it difficult to find a guest star that suits their needs for their event. The purpose of this research is to build an e-marketplace application as a web-based decision support system that can be used to find alternative decisions to choose guest stars according to the criteria using product weighting methods. The weighted product method is one of the methods that can be applied to web-based decision support system applications for determining guest stars in e-marketplaces. There are three criteria used to determine guest stars in this e-marketplace, these criteria are the type of show, price and location. As for the alternatives that were tested, there were nine alternatives consisting of guest stars in Yogyakarta. Functionality testing is carried out using the black box method and the result is that all functions and validation buttons on the e-marketplace can function properly. The result of calculation using the weighted product method is the guest star with the highest yield is Frengki Sermadi with a value of 0.135234, while the guest star with the lowest result is Sanggar Titik Dua with a value of 0.083222.
